The first step in Mackeeper Troubleshoot is identifying the issue. Common problems include app crashes, slow performance, failed installations, or error codes. Understanding the exact problem makes it easier to follow the correct solution path and prevents further complications.
For performance issues, Mackeeper Troubleshoot includes scanning the system for unnecessary files, cache buildup, and temporary data that may slow down the Mac. Removing these items often improves speed and frees storage space. The Mackeeper dashboard provides simple tools for this process.
Network and connectivity errors are also common, especially when the app cannot verify subscriptions or update features. During Mackeeper Troubleshoot, checking the internet connection, restarting the Mac, and updating the app often resolves these issues. Proper network settings ensure uninterrupted access to all Mackeeper services.
Error codes are another reason to perform Mackeeper Troubleshoot. These codes indicate specific issues, such as licensing conflicts, malware alerts, or system incompatibilities. Documenting the error code and consulting the Mackeeper support page or knowledge base helps users apply the correct solution efficiently.
Reinstallation is a useful step during Mackeeper Troubleshoot. If app files become corrupted or certain features fail to load, uninstalling and reinstalling Mackeeper often restores full functionality. Always use the official Mackeeper website for the download to ensure security and reliability.
Account-related problems can also require Mackeeper Troubleshoot. Issues with signing in, subscription verification, or license activation may prevent access to premium features. Ensuring credentials are correct and contacting Mackeeper support if necessary resolves these account errors.
For malware detection or removal failures, Mackeeper Troubleshoot includes running deep system scans and following the recommended security actions. The app provides step-by-step guidance to safely remove threats without risking important files or system integrity.
